Warp Tiger

Warp tiger with flexible bones.jpg

This tiger has purple and black stripes.

Warp tigers are not particularly smart, can speak, and know every language. Warp tigers frequently team together with thought parrots.

Warp Tiger
Elite   —   27 points
AD  9     GD 5     Will 1     HP  1     Toughness 4
Accuracy  1     Save DC 7
Stealth 1     Perception 1     Agility 6
Descriptors  [ Blooded ], [ Bony ], [ Living ], [ Purple ]
Movement  55 meter land speed with 6 meter jump. 55 meter teleport speed. 55 meter swim speed with 5 meter sink.
Size  2 meters     Reach 1.5 meters
Weight 500 Kilograms
Basic Specialties  Avoider, Defensive, Offensive, Well-Rounded, Brutal
Advanced Specialties  Avoider, Aggressive
Extras  Big, Fast

The warp tiger's unarmed attacks deal 1d6+2 damage and an additional +1 damage when charging (damage bonus included). Its acute sense of space lets it detect and pinpoint any extradimensional space with an entry point within 50 meters.

Advancement

Controlled Run (5 points): When running with its teleport speed, instead of randomly going to one of the three chosen places, it randomly determines one of the three places that it can't go, and teleports to one of the other two. When running with any other speed, it may turn once. The Warp Tiger gets two Advanced Specialties.

Rending Claws (5 points): When the Warp Tiger makes an unarmed attack as a heavy attack, and inflicts any wounds, the wounded creature gets a -1 penalty to Toughness for 1 minute. The Warp Tiger gets two Advanced Specialties.

Warpichore (10 points): The Warp Tiger gains a spiked tail, which serves as a Teleporting Tail weapon: it makes melee attacks through portals against targets up to 50 meters away, and deals 1d6+2 Physical damage (damage bonus included). The Warp Tiger gets four Advanced Specialties.
